Mary Jacobus combines close readings with theoretical concerns in an examination of the many forms taken by the mythic or phantasmic mother in literary, psychoanalytic and artistic representations.

Mary Jacobus is John Wendell Anderson Professor of English at Cornell University.

Contents; Freud's mnemonic: screen memories and feminist nostalgia -- In parenthesis: immaculate conceptions and feminine desire -- Russian tactics: Freud's "Case of Homosexuality in a Woman" -- In love with a cold climate: travelling with Wollstonecraft -- Malthus, matricide, and the Marquis de Sade -- Replacing the race of mothers: AIDS and The Last Man -- "Tea Daddy": poor Mrs. Klein and the pencil shavings -- "'Cos of the Horse": the origin of questions -- Portrait of the artist as a young dog -- Incorruptible milk: breast-feeding and the French revolution -- Baring the breast: mastectomy and the surgical analogy -- Narcissa's gaze: Berthe Morisot and the filial mirror.
